Maison >Java >javaDidacticiel >Utilisez Java pour écrire une solution au problème du singe mangeant des pêches
Description du titre :
Wukong a cueilli quelques pêches le premier jour et en a mangé la moitié immédiatement. Lorsqu'il n'était pas satisfait, il en a mangé une de plus le deuxième jour, il a mangé la moitié et une autre des pêches restantes. plus de la moitié des pêches restantes de la veille chaque jour, et quand j'étais prêt à manger le nième jour, il ne restait qu'une seule pêche. Si vous êtes intelligent, s'il vous plaît, aidez Wukong à calculer combien de pêches il y avait lorsqu'il a commencé à manger le premier jour ?
Tutoriels vidéo associés recommandés : tutoriel Java en ligne
Entrée :
Saisissez un nombre n (1<=n<=30).
Sortie :
Affichez le nombre de pêches le premier jour.
Exemple de saisie :
3
Exemple de résultat :
10
Code du programme :
importjava.util.*;
publicclassMain
{
publicstaticvoidmain(String[]args)
{
Scannerinput=newScanner(System.in);
intn=input.nextInt();
inta=1;
pour(inti=1;i
{
une=(une+1)*2;
}
System.out.println(a);
}
}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!